WebMay 28, 2024 · Natural gas supplies to the LNG terminal will come either from the U.S. Rockies via the Ruby Pipeline or the Gas Transmission Northwest (GTN) pipeline from British Columbia both of which terminate in Malin hub in Oregon. Natural gas from Malin, Oregon will feed into the Pacific Connector Gas Pipeline which will go directly to Jordan Cove. WebCompressed natural gas (CNG) carrier ships are those designed for transportation of natural gas under high pressure. [1] CNG carrier technology relies on high pressure, typically over 250 bar (2900 psi ), to increase the density of the gas, but it is still 2.4 times less than that of LNG (426 kg/m 3 ). [2]

WebDec 27, 2024 · Natural gas is a fossil fuel energy source. Natural gas contains many different compounds. The largest component of natural gas is methane, a compound with one carbon atom and four hydrogen atoms (CH 4 ).
